Transaction 1509709f7a5f6a8df021b7e69ccd1123a22364fc086920aaf8bc1e290d261527

1 Input
2 Outputs
  • 1509709f7a5f6a8df021b7e69ccd1123a22364fc086920aaf8bc1e290d261527:0
  • value  1504113
    address  3MN3cRZpkJuARHaiWkKmmVmQuxK8iFUk6E
  • 1509709f7a5f6a8df021b7e69ccd1123a22364fc086920aaf8bc1e290d261527:1
  • value  38774
    address  39UwdvAy18Hd5CA7vq3AP5vGBK2RUbFuC9